Background: Simulation-based education is a widely utilized tool for experiential learning in nursing education. The aim of this study was to determine nursing students’ performance and satisfaction in the classification of pressure injuries using simulation with moulage. Methods: It is an evaluation study with a quasi-experimental, single-group, post-test design that was conducted in the spring semester of the 2019-2020 academic year in the Nursing Department of the Faculty of Health Sciences of Izmir Katip Celebi University, Izmir, Turkey. In total, 66 final-year nursing students, voluntarily participated in the Assessment of Pressure Injury Course. A student characteristics form, a Pressure Injury Classification Form, and a Moulage Satisfaction and Evaluation Form were used as data collection tools. Data were entered into SPSS v. 21, and the results of the analysis were described using descriptive statistics. Results: It was found that 67.2% (n=45) of the students correctly assessed all the stages of pressure injury moulages on the standardized patients. Among the students, 62.1% (n=41) strongly agreed that their assessment skills of pressure injury improved after the simulation. The results related to students’ satisfaction indicated that 77.3% (n=51) of the students evaluated the moulages as realistic. The Mean±SD total score of students’ evaluation of moulage simulation sessions on standard patients was 4.56±0.59 (range=1-5). Conclusion: This moulage is a simple, easily accessible, low-cost, and effective tool for teaching pressure injury assessment to nursing students. It can be used in clinical skills training and clinical assessment in nursing education.

COVID-19 impacted in person learning, particularly for the health sciences. Nursing students learn valuable clinical skills in simulation labs on campus. When one university campus stopped in person instruction during the 2020 spring semester, two librarians worked together to identify resources to support a nursing course that quickly switched to remote learning. These resources ranged from library licensed content to free virtual reality simulations. In order to identify materials, the librarians first defined visual literacy within nursing, as well as met with various constituents to understand curriculum goals and needs. Making connections with both the faculty and the curriculum was the impetus for examining similarities between the Association of College and Research Libraries Visual Literacy Competency Standards and the American Association of Colleges of Nursing Clinical Resources Essentials for Baccalaureate Nursing Education. Both librarians are eager to continue working on strategically and systematically incorporating visual literacy library instruction into the nursing curriculum.

Abstract Background:Clinical education is an essential part of nursing education. Selected clinical teaching methods influence it. Simulation-based mastery learning has been used to improve clinical skills among nursing students and may provide a novel way to enhance nursing skills.The object of this study was to assessthe effect of the simulation-based mastery learning on the clinicalskills of undergraduate nursing students from 2017 till 2019.Methods:This study was a quasi-experimental study withtwo groups (the control and intervention).After receiving written consent, one 117 studentsselected random convenience sampling. The intervention group participated in a simulation-based mastery learning intervention, and the control group received no intervention except for traditional training.The students of both groups completed the demographic information questionnaire and the checklist before and after the intervention. The results were analyzed by SPSS version 21 using descriptive and inferential statistics.Results:The results showed that there were no significant differences between the two groups before the intervention (p> o.o5). Also, that students’ performance in the intervention group and control group improved significantly at the post-test compared to baseline(p<0.05), implying that the simulation-based mastery model of the intervention group significantly more effective compared to that of the control.Conclusion: Thesefindings showed that mastery learning strategy improved the clinical skills ofundergraduatenursing students.The results suggest that other nursing and health profession’s programs can develop a successful mastery-based learning model.

Background: Nursing students’ satisfaction with their undergraduate program is essential and can serve as an instrument of assessment of institutional effectiveness and success. Objective: To evaluate and understanding student satisfaction with nursing program in areas of curriculum, college environment, Faculty and clinical interaction with the college of nursing at university of sulaimani. Methods: Cross sectional study was conducted for 170 students in nursing college at university of sulaimani, from period of 1st November to 25th February to identify their satisfaction with the nursing program. A non probability \ purposive sampling technique was applied to 170 the students of nursing studying in the second to fourth year. A questionnaire was constructed by the researchers to elicit the detailed information related to study objectives. Subjects were completed as interview technique. Content and Face Validity of the instrument was established and the reliability was measured by using Cronbach’s alpha = 0.96. Formula in the questionnaire list. All statistical computation is enhanced using statistical method (SPSS 21) The result of the study showed that More than half (51.76) of the study participants were barely satisfied, younger students had greater satisfaction comparing their peers. There were no significant associations between students’ satisfaction with the nursing program dimensions and participant’s age and academic level. Conclusion: Generally, the findings of the study showed that students’ satisfaction with a nursing program was neutral. The study gets the attention to the many positive as well as negative aspects of the clinical experience of the nursing students at the college, and the need to rethink clinical skills training in nursing education.

e-Learning and other innovative open learning multimedia modalities of delivering education are being introduced to enhance learning opportunities and facilitate student access to and success in education. This article reports on a study that assessed students' readiness to make the shift from traditional learning to the technological culture of e-Learning at a university in Durban. A quasi-experimental study design was employed to assess such readiness in first year nursing students before and after an appropriate educational intervention. A modified Chapnick Readiness Score was used to measure their psychological, equipment and technological readiness for the change in learning method. It was found that, while students' psychological readiness for e-Learning was high, they lacked technological and equipment readiness. Although e-Learning could be used in nursing education, technological and equipment readiness require attention before it can be implemented effectively in this institution. Fortunately, these technical aspects are easier to resolve than improving psychological readiness.

Abstract Background Self-directed learning is important in nursing as it is associated with improved clinical and moral competencies in providing quality and cost-effective care among people. However, unethical professional conduct demonstrated by some graduate nurses is linked with the way they are developed in schools alongside the content and pedagogies prescribed in nursing curricula. Pedagogical transformations appear to be inevitable to develop enthusiastic nursing students who can work independently in delivering quality and cost-effective nursing services to people. This study intended to examine the impact of facilitation in a problem-based pedagogy on self-directed learning readiness among undergraduate nursing students in Tanzania. Methods A controlled quasi-experimental design was conducted in Tanzanian higher training institutions from January to April 2019. A 40-item Self-directed learning Readiness scale for nursing education adopted from previous studies measured self-directed learning and the Student A descriptive analysis via a Statistical Package for Social Sciences software program (version 23) was performed to establish nursing students’ socio-demographic characteristics profiles. Independent samples t-test determined mean scores difference of self-directed learning readiness among nursing students between groups while regression analysis was performed to discriminate the effect of an intervention controlled with other co-related factors. Results The post-test results of self-directed learning readiness showed that nursing students scored significantly higher [(M = 33.01 ± 13.17; t (399) = 2.335; 95%CI: 0.486,5.668)] in the intervention group than their counterparts in the control. Findings of SDL readiness subscales were significantly higher among students in the intervention including self-management [(M = 10.11 ± 4.09; t (399) = 1.354; 95%CI: 0.173,4.026)], interest learning [(M = 9.21 ± 2.39; t (399) = 1.189; 95%CI: 0.166,4.323)] and self-control [(M = 13.63 ± 5.05; t (399) = 2.335; 95%CI: 0.486,5.668)]. The probability of nursing students to demonstrate self-directed learning readiness was 1.291 more times higher when exposed to the intervention (AOR = 1.291, p < 0.05, 95%CI: 0.767, 2.173) than in the control. Conclusion Facilitation in a problem-based pedagogy promises to change the spectrum of nursing learning habits potentially to their academic and professional achievements. Nurse tutors need to be empowered with it to prepare nursing students to meet their academic and professional potentials.

INTRODUCTION: Nursing students suffer from high levels of stress related to academic assignments in addition to clinical skills training. As a psychosocial phenomenon, stress affects students’ academic achievement and wellbeing. Coping mechanisms help students deal with the challenges arising from stress.AIMS: To illustrate the level of stress and common stressors among nursing students; to describe the difference in stress level related to demographic data; and to identify coping mechanisms used by nursing students.METHODS: A descriptive cross-sectional study was carried out to determine the type of stress and coping strategies among nursing students. The level of stress was evaluated through Perceived Stress Scale (PSS) and type of coping strategies were assessed by use of Coping Behaviours Inventory (CBI).RESULTS: Students perceived moderate level of stress, most commonly attributed to assignments and workload, teachers and nursing staff, peers and daily life, and taking care of patients. The most frequently used coping mechanism was problem solving. The study found that age, GPA, education level and residence are good predictors of the use of transference as a coping behaviour.CONCLUSION: A moderate level of stress among students illustrates the need for stress management programs and the provision of suitable support.

Background and objective: The use of technology has become the norm in nursing education. While technology has opened up for more flexible, active, student-focused teaching methods, its introduction has also brought challenges regarding its use and implementation. Recent literature has concentrated on how to best implement technology, but little attention has focused on observing student practices during technology use. Therefore, it is unknown how to optimize technology use within clinical skills training. The objective of this study was to investigate how groups of nursing students utilize a technology-based learning tool.Methods: An observational study with an exploratory design was implemented using video recordings as the data material.Results: The results indicated a high level of variability in nursing students’ performance and ability to utilize a technological tool while working in groups. The variability during clinical skills training was associated with four factors: level of competence, motivation to learn, role clarification, and collaborative problem-solving skills.Conclusions: The results of the study indicated variability in groups of nursing students’ ability to employ a technological tool during a selected procedure—namely, wound care and dressing. These findings suggest that a set of implications for faculty members should be developed. Specifically, staff and students should be prepared prior to using technology by focusing on group dynamics, group composition, development of collaborative problem-solving skills, and role modeling.

Nursing graduates need to be “real world ready”, and able to meet the demands of the healthcare workforce. Research indicates that baccalaureate graduates have adequate theoretical base, but often lack competence in the clinical setting. Preceptorship programs are an effective way of developing clinical competence in the nursing student. The purpose of this study was to compare a traditional senior clinical course to a preceptorship model on students, faculty, and nurses’ perceptions of student preparedness for the nursing role. A formal preceptorship program with the support of a clinical nurse faculty member was developed to enhance the success of clinical nursing education. A quasi-experimental design with nonequivalent groups was used to determine the feasibility and effectiveness of a preceptorship model for senior nursing students comparing the students’, the faculty, and the nurses’ perceptions of the students’ preparedness for clinical practice after a traditional clinical and a preceptor clinical experience. The sample consisted of the fall 2017 senior semester cohort and the spring 2018 senior semester cohort, senior faculty who taught in those semesters, and nurses at the participating facilities. Overall, findings did not show a statistically significant difference between the traditional cohorts and the precepted cohorts; however, there is evidence of clinical significance. After implementation of the preceptorship model, there was an increase in the percent of nurses (100%), faculty (100%), and students (95%) who felt that the senior nursing students were ready for the professional role of a registered nurse.

Preparation for clinical practice is arguably a vital component of undergraduate nursing education with clinical laboratories widely adopted as a strategy to support student development of clinical skills. However, there is little empirical evidence about the role laboratories play in students' learning or how they assist in linking theory to practice. This study aimed to explore the current clinical laboratory practices in Schools of Nursing in regional Victoria, Australia through site visits, interviews and review of curricula. Findings revealed that approaches to laboratory learning are based on traditions rather than evidence, and have evolved in response to fiscal and environmental challenges. The predominance of teacher talk in the laboratory, has lead to acute care over other areas of practice. This study indicates a need for rigorous investigation of pedagogies that can support nursing students in preparation for clinical practice. It remains unclear if laboratory learning experiences assist students in the translation of theoretical knowledge to practice.

Introduction: An exit evaluation study by the final year graduating students was done Just prior to the completion of the third batch of the MBBS program at Asia Metropolitan University (AMU).Objective: (1) To determine whether the MBBS program had enabled the students to (a)attain the eight Program Learning outcomes (PLO); (b)to achieve the eight major competency areas expected upon completion of the program; and (2) To look into the strengths and weaknesses of the program from the graduating final year students’ perspectives.Methods: A descriptive study was done among 18 medical students who were doing senior clerkship posting. A self-administered questionnaire including one open ended question was used for the study. Informed consent was obtained from the participants, assuring them on confidentiality. Data gathered were analysed using SPSS version 23.Results: Most of the students (77%) feel that the program had enabled them to attain each one of the eight Program Learning Outcomes(PLO); between 60-78% achieved competencies in each one of the eight major areas expected at the end of course. The strengths included experienced lecturers, smooth implementation of the program, well designed curriculum while weakness was deficiency in clinical skills, training facilities, number of lecturers, case mix and adequacy of clinical exposure. The weaknesses include readiness to be a self-directed learner.Conclusion: Majority of the students attained each of the eight (PLO) competencies. The strengths were identified and discussed.
